Description
ClassUIEnhanced
A comprehensive class UI replacement that brings your cooldowns, resources, cast bars, and buffs together into one fully customizable, anchored layout — all configurable directly through WoW's Edit Mode.
Works with or without Blizzard's Cooldown Manager. CDM is opt-in per profile: the Essential, Utility, Buff, and Buff Bar trackers use it when enabled; cast bars, resource bars, health bar, GCD, and the trinket / racial / consumable / consumable-buff / raid-buff / outbound-buff trackers all work standalone.
Cooldown & Buff Trackers
Nine trackers with four sizing modes, multi-row overflow, and independent layouts:
- Essential Cooldowns — core class abilities
- Utility Cooldowns — secondary utility abilities
- Buff Tracker — tracked buffs and debuffs with pandemic border glow
- Buff Tracker Bars — buff durations as progress bars (icon & name, icon only, name only, or bar only)
- Trinket Tracker — on-use trinket cooldowns with auto-detection and reserve slots
- Consumable Tracker — potions and healthstones with item counts and "best only" logic
- Consumable Buff Tracker — flask, food, augment rune, weapon oil, and weapon buff status with missing-buff glow and click-to-use
- Raid Buff Tracker — class raid buff status with missing-buff glow and click-to-cast
- Outbound Buff Tracker — buffs you apply on party/raid members (e.g. Prescience) rendered as horizontal status bars with class-colored recipient names and remaining duration
- Racial Tracker — racial ability cooldowns with auto-detection
All icon trackers support keybind and button-press overlays, GCD swipe hiding, and configurable glow effects (ready flash, pulse, approaching cooldown, low health border). Essential and Utility cooldowns also surface Blizzard's Assisted Combat rotation hint as a marching-ants overlay on the suggested next-cast spell.
Cast Bars
Custom cast bars with per-state colors, optional vertical orientation, text display options, and spell icon:
- Player Cast Bar — with channeled spell tick marks
- Target Cast Bar — with optional non-interruptible shield indicator
- Focus Cast Bar — with optional non-interruptible shield indicator
- Global Cooldown — GCD timer bar with real measured client-server latency overlay
Resource Bars
- Primary Resource — all power types with bar smoothing, value display, per-type colors, mana auto-hide for DPS specs, and per-spec breakpoint pips; Augmentation Evokers see Ebon Might duration in place of mana with granted main-stat value, crit-roll highlight, and empower-cast extension preview
- Player Health Bar — class-color or health-gradient coloring with heal prediction and absorption overlays
- Secondary Resource — combo points, soul shards, holy power, chi, arcane charges, runes, essence, soul fragments, and stagger as individual bars with smooth fill, per-resource colors, and builder prediction; spec-aware (rune sorting, charged combo points, Fire Blast recharge, Maelstrom stacks, Essence Burst, Crusading Strikes, skyriding vigor, and more)
Appearance & Edit Mode
Independent borders (color, thickness, inside/outside), icon zoom with aspect-ratio control, optional component backgrounds, and configurable fonts and shadows. Every component is a first-class Edit Mode citizen: drag to position, anchor chains between components, width inheritance (percentage or absolute), cascading opacity, and stackable visibility rules (mounted, out of combat, no target) with per-component show/hide toggles.
Custom Trackers, Custom Spells & Icon Overrides
Pull specific spells from any tracker into independent Custom Trackers that can also serve as anchor targets. Add your own Custom Spells to the Essential, Utility, Buff, and Buff Bar trackers — user-pinned spell IDs render alongside the Blizzard-driven entries. Replace any tracked spell's icon via a searchable icon picker — overrides apply everywhere the spell appears.
Profiles
Create, switch, copy, and reset profiles. Import/export full profiles or individual segments as compressed strings. Per-spec Blizzard Cooldown Manager layout sync and automatic profile switching by specialization or role.
Integrations
- Wago — public API for Wago Companion and UI pack installers
- External addons — register frames as anchor parents via
ClassUIEnhancedAPI.AddAnchors() - Localization — all 11 WoW client languages; translate on CurseForge
Getting Started
Type /cue or click the minimap button (left-click for Edit Mode, right-click for Options). Also available from the addon compartment.
Links
- Discord: https://discord.gg/8dWuth44Dx
- Donations: cont1nuity · tercio
- Patreon: cont1nuity · tercio


